Abstract
The invention discloses a medical waste treatment system; the device comprises a sorting station, an isolation station, a disinfectant disinfection station, a disinfectant mixing station, a disinfectant recovery station, a high-temperature steam disinfection station, a crushing station, a recovery station, an incineration station, a high-temperature steam disinfection water supply station and a burying station; the medical waste incineration system is used for sorting the medical waste, further realizing different treatments on different medical wastes, preventing the medical wastes from being polluted due to mixing, sterilizing the medical waste through a disinfectant and high-temperature steam, preventing the medical waste from being polluted during treatment, and provided with the crushing station for crushing the medical waste, so that the medical waste can be incinerated more fully, and the recycling station is provided with a plurality of places for recycling, crushing and recovering the recyclable medical waste, recycling the heat of the incineration station, increasing the utilization rate of waste treatment and realizing environmental protection.

Background
Medical waste may contain a large amount of pathogenic microorganisms and harmful chemicals, and even radioactive and harmful substances, so that the medical waste is an important risk factor causing disease transmission or related public health problems, and the medical waste includes infectious waste, pathological waste, harmful waste, pharmaceutical waste and chemical waste, however, various medical waste treatments in the market still have various problems.
Although a medical waste treatment system disclosed in the publication No. CN109304349A realizes the purpose of degrading pollutants by fenton reagent and heating for sterilization, and simultaneously, performs jet combustion treatment on the used fenton reagent to sufficiently combust the used fenton reagent, compared with the existing treatment method of directly incinerating medical waste, the scheme can sterilize, reduce the emission of harmful substances, and reduce the pollution to the environment, but does not solve the problems of the existing medical waste classification treatment, the inability of recycling, the insufficient utilization of incineration stations, and the like, and thus a medical waste treatment system is proposed.

Detailed Description

Referring to fig. 1, the present invention provides a technical solution:
a medical waste treatment system is characterized by comprising a sorting station 1, an isolation station 2, a disinfectant disinfection station 3, a disinfectant mixing station 5, a disinfectant recovery station 8, a high-temperature steam disinfection station 11, a crushing station 12, a recovery station 15, an incineration station 16, a high-temperature steam disinfection water supply station 22 and a burying station 23;
the sorting station 1 is used for sorting the medical waste and classifying different medical wastes;
the isolation station 2 is used for storing the medical waste with radioactivity sorted by the sorting station 1, so that the leakage of the medical waste with radioactivity is prevented;
the disinfectant disinfection station 3 is used for spraying and disinfecting the medical waste sorted by the sorting station 1, and can remove bacteria on the upper part of the medical waste;
the disinfectant mixing station 5 is used for mixing disinfectant, and the mixed disinfectant is conveyed to the interior of the disinfectant sterilizing station 3 to sterilize medical wastes;
the disinfectant recovery station 8 is used for recovering the disinfectant used by the disinfectant disinfection station 3, so that resource waste is prevented;
the high-temperature steam disinfection station 11 is used for disinfecting and sterilizing the medical waste sprayed and disinfected by the disinfectant disinfection solution disinfection station 3 through high-temperature steam, and is used for killing viruses in the medical waste and preventing the viruses from spreading;
the crushing station 12 is used for crushing the medical waste sterilized by the disinfectant sterilizing station 3 and the high-temperature steam sterilizing station 11, so that the medical waste can be completely combusted in the incineration station 16;
the recycling station 15 is used for recycling the materials which are crushed by the crushing station 12 and have recycling function, so that the resource consumption is reduced;
the incineration station 16 is used for incinerating the medical waste crushed by the crushing station 12 and treating the medical waste;
the high-temperature steam disinfection water supply station 22 is used for generating high-temperature steam to disinfect and sterilize medical wastes in the high-temperature steam disinfection station 11, and the high-temperature steam disinfection water supply station 22 is fixedly connected with the incineration station 16 to fully utilize heat in the incineration station;
the burial station 23 is used for burying ash in the incineration station 16 and burying medical waste which does not need to be incinerated inside the high temperature steam sterilization station 11.
In order to sterilize medical waste inside the disinfectant sterilizing station 3 and convey disinfectant, in this embodiment, preferably, a nozzle 4 is fixedly installed on the upper portion of the disinfectant sterilizing station 3, the nozzle 4 is fixedly communicated with the disinfectant mixing station 5 through a conveying pipeline, and a one-way valve 24 is fixedly installed on the conveying pipeline.

In order to realize recycling of the tail gas of the incineration station 16, in this embodiment, it is preferable that one side of the incineration station 16 is fixedly connected with an exhaust pipe 17, the exhaust pipe 17 is fixedly connected with an induced fan 18, the exhaust pipe 17 is fixedly connected with a tail gas treatment box 19, the exhaust pipe 17 is fixedly provided with a heater 20 and a blower fan 21, and the other end of the exhaust pipe 17 is fixedly connected with the high-temperature steam sterilization station 11.
In order to achieve high-temperature sterilization and disinfection of the high-temperature steam sterilization station 11, in this embodiment, preferably, one end of the high-temperature steam sterilization water supply station 22 is fixedly connected to the high-temperature steam sterilization station 11 through a second one-way valve 26.

In order to prevent the radioactive waste from leaking, in this embodiment, it is preferable that the isolation station 2 is made of two steel plates with a thickness of three centimeters, and a concrete wall with a thickness of ten centimeters is fixedly poured between the two steel plates.
The invention has the following use process:
the first embodiment is as follows: when the medical waste does not contain viruses and radioactivity;
the medical wastes are sorted through the sorting station 1, so that the medical wastes can be classified, after sorting, the classified medical wastes are conveyed to the inside of the disinfectant sterilizing station 3, then disinfectant is conveyed through the disinfectant mixing station 5, the medical wastes are sterilized, the scattered disinfectant can be filtered, purified and recycled through the disinfectant recycling station 8 to prevent waste, then the medical wastes are conveyed to the inside of the high-temperature steam sterilizing station 11 to be sterilized by high-temperature steam, the high-temperature steam sterilizing water supply station 22 is heated by using the heat of the incineration station 16, and when the tail gas of the incineration station 16 is discharged, the tail gas is treated through the tail gas treatment box 19 and then conveyed to the inside of the high-temperature steam sterilizing station 11 to be sufficiently utilized, and the sterilized medical wastes are crushed through the crushing station 12, then, the recyclable waste such as a scalpel and glass is transported to the recycling station 15 to be recycled, and other medical waste is transported to the incineration station 16 to be incinerated, and then the incinerated ash is buried in the burying station 23.
Example two: when the medical waste is pathological;

Example three: when the medical waste is radioactive:
after the radioactive waste is taken out from the sorting station 1, the radioactive waste is directly placed in the isolation station 2 for long-term isolation, so that the radioactive waste is slowly attenuated.
